This:

I like how the melody has been used in the main themes for Oblivion and now Skyrim, in slightly different forms.
Morrowind had a slow, kind of magical sound. Oblivion was more imposing, and made you think of khights in shining armour. Lastly Skyrim, that has a more rugged sound, kind of barbarian; which fits perfectly with the suroundings.
